What is Microdosing? Defining the Concept
Microdosing represents a nuanced approach to consuming psychedelic substances at subclinical levels, designed to enhance cognitive function and emotional well-being without inducing traditional hallucinogenic experiences. Unlike recreational drug use, microdosing as self-care involves consuming extremely small, precisely measured quantities of substances like psilocybin mushrooms that produce subtle neurological and psychological benefits.
The Science Behind Microdosing
At its core, microdosing operates through intricate neurochemical interactions. When consuming minute quantities of psychedelic compounds, typically 5-10% of a standard recreational dose, the brain experiences subtle neuroplastic changes. Neurological research from Johns Hopkins University suggests these microscopic doses can potentially modulate serotonin receptors, enhance neural connectivity, and support cognitive flexibility without triggering intense psychedelic experiences.
Key neurological interactions during microdosing include:
- Potential activation of 5-HT2A serotonin receptors
- Subtle modulation of default mode network functionality
- Mild enhancement of neuroplasticity and synaptic connectivity

How Microdosing Works: The Science Behind It
Microdosing operates through sophisticated neurochemical mechanisms that subtly interact with brain receptors and neural networks, creating nuanced changes in cognitive and emotional processing without inducing full psychedelic experiences. This precise approach involves consuming infinitesimal quantities of psychoactive compounds to trigger specific neurological responses.
Neuroreceptor Interaction and Synaptic Modulation
Research from neuroscience experts reveals that psychedelic compounds like psilocybin primarily engage with serotonin 5-HT2A receptors, facilitating complex neurological interactions. These microscopic interventions potentially enhance neural plasticity, allowing the brain to form new connections and recalibrate existing neural pathways more efficiently.
Key neurological mechanisms during microdosing include:
- Subtle activation of serotonergic receptors
- Potential enhancement of neuroplasticity
- Mild modulation of default mode network functionality
